Cate Blanchett Says ‘I Am Serious About Giving Up Acting’: There Are ‘A Lot of Things I Want to Do With My Life’


Cate Blanchett says she will no be an actor forever.

That’s not to say retirement is imminent for the two-time Oscar winner (“The Aviator” and “Blue Jasmine”), but there will come a time when Blanchett leaves the profession behind. Blanchett most recently starred opposite Michael Fassbender in Steven Soderbergh’s acclaimed spy drama “Black Bag,” which has earned $21 million at the domestic box office. Blanchett will next be seen opposite Adam Driver in Jim Jarmusch’s new movie, “Father, Mother, Sister, Brother.” The supporting cast also includes Vicky Krieps, Mayim Bialik, Tom Waits, Charlotte Rampling, Indya Moore and Luka Sabbat.
